Why Brisbane Gardens Need More Frequent Maintenance

Brisbane sits in a subtropical climate zone where warm temperatures and regular rainfall create ideal growing conditions. While this is great news for your garden, it also means lawns, hedges, and weeds grow faster than in cooler southern cities.

Summer growth rates in Brisbane can be double those of Melbourne or Sydney. Popular grass types like Buffalo and Couch can grow several centimetres per week during the peak October to March period, while weeds like Nut Grass and Bindii thrive in the warm, humid conditions.

A regular maintenance plan ensures your garden stays on top of this growth rather than playing catch-up. Consistent care also promotes healthier plants, better lawn density, and fewer pest and disease problems.

Seasonal Maintenance Calendar

Spring (Sep-Nov)

Heavy growth period. Increase mowing frequency. Apply fertiliser. Pre-emergent weed control.

Summer (Dec-Feb)

Peak growth. Weekly mowing recommended. Deep watering. Storm damage clean-ups.

Autumn (Mar-May)

Apply mulch before dry season. Reduce mowing height gradually. Major pruning window.

Winter (Jun-Aug)

Slower growth. Fortnightly or monthly mowing. Ideal time for structural pruning and clean-ups.
